Photography enthusiasts know that timing is everything. Whether you're capturing a fleeting smile or a stunning sunset, having the right tools can make all the difference. Shutter releases are essential accessories for photographers, offering precision and control. Let's explore the types available and find the best fit for your needs.
Wireless remote controls are perfect for photographers who value freedom and flexibility. These devices allow you to trigger your camera's shutter without touching it, which is ideal for long exposures or group shots. They work via infrared or Bluetooth, offering a range of up to several metres. This means you can set up your camera and move around freely to find the best angle. Some models even let you control multiple cameras simultaneously.
Radio frequency (RF) shutter releases are known for their reliability and long-range capabilities. They use radio waves to communicate with your camera, making them less prone to interference compared to infrared models. RF options are great for wildlife photography, where you need to be far from your subject. They also work well in crowded areas where line of sight might be obstructed. Many RF models offer additional features like interval shooting and bulb mode.
Wired shutter releases are straightforward and reliable. They connect directly to your camera via a cable, ensuring a stable connection. These are perfect for studio settings or when you want to minimise the risk of wireless interference. Wired options are often more affordable and don't require batteries, making them a practical choice for many photographers. They're especially useful for long exposure shots, where even the slightest camera shake can ruin the image.
When choosing a shutter release, consider the power source. Many wireless models use AA (LR06) batteries, which are easy to find and replace. This is convenient for photographers on the go, as you can carry spare batteries and swap them out as needed. Some models also offer rechargeable options, reducing the need for constant battery changes.

Choosing the right shutter release depends on your photography style and needs. Consider where and how you shoot most often. If you're in a studio, a wired release might be the best choice. For outdoor or wildlife photography, an RF model could offer the range and reliability you need. And if you value flexibility, a wireless remote control might be the way to go.
